    The Influence of Long-Term Living on Interior Planning Decisions

    Interior planning in Singapore has undergone a noticeable transformation as long-term living becomes a dominant consideration. Buyers are no longer focused solely on decorative appeal at the point of purchase. Instead, they are assessing how interior spaces will perform over many years of daily use.

    This shift has encouraged a move away from trend-driven interiors toward designs that prioritise flexibility, durability, and long-term comfort. Interior planning is now closely aligned with lifestyle longevity rather than short-term aesthetics.

    Interiors Designed for Extended Occupancy

    Long-term living requires interiors that can adapt without constant redesign. Buyers prefer spaces that allow personalisation over time while maintaining functionality. Neutral foundations, flexible room usage, and practical finishes support this adaptability.

    Fixed interior elements that limit future changes are increasingly viewed as restrictive. Homeowners want the freedom to evolve their living environment as tastes and needs change.

    As a result, interior planning has become more strategic and future-focused.

    Practical Design Over Decorative Trends

    Trend-heavy interiors may generate early excitement but often lack durability. Features that feel fashionable at launch can become impractical or dated with extended use.

    Long-term buyers value interiors that prioritise comfort, ease of maintenance, and adaptability. Practical layouts, durable finishes, and efficient storage solutions reduce the need for frequent renovations.

    This approach aligns interior planning with long-term ownership goals rather than short-term impressions.

    Interior Planning and Emotional Comfort

    Well-planned interiors contribute to emotional comfort and long-term satisfaction. Homes that feel easy to live in foster a stronger sense of belonging and stability.

    When residents are not constantly adjusting or redesigning their space, stress is reduced. This comfort supports longer occupancy and deeper attachment to the home.

    Interior planning that supports emotional well-being is now recognised as a core element of residential quality.

    Long-Term Value of Thoughtful Interiors

    Interiors designed for longevity tend to age better in the market. Buyers recognise the value of spaces that remain relevant and functional over time, even as design preferences evolve.

    These homes often maintain stronger resale appeal and experience less depreciation related to outdated interiors.
